What is AIOS?

    AIOS (AI Agent Operating System) is an open-source framework that embeds LLMs into the operating system, creating a specialized kernel to manage AI agent resources like memory, storage, and scheduling for faster deployment and execution.

    AIOS in Simple Terms

    Think of your computer's operating system (Windows, macOS, Linux). It manages programs, memory, and files so everything runs smoothly. Now imagine an operating system designed specifically for AI agents—that's AIOS.

    Instead of managing traditional programs, AIOS manages AI agents powered by Large Language Models. It gives each agent the memory, storage, and processing time it needs, prevents agents from interfering with each other, and ensures the most important agents get priority—just like how your OS manages your apps.

    Key Components of AIOS

    LLM Kernel

    Embeds language models directly into the OS kernel, providing native-level access and performance for AI agent operations.

    Agent Scheduler

    Intelligently schedules agent execution, managing priorities and ensuring critical agents get resources first.

    Memory Manager

    Optimizes context windows, conversation history, and working memory across all running agents.

    Agent Runtime

    Provides a production-ready execution environment for deploying, monitoring, and scaling LLM-based agents.

    Frequently Asked Questions About AIOS

    What is AIOS (AI Agent Operating System)?

    AIOS (AI Agent Operating System) is an open-source framework that embeds Large Language Models (LLMs) directly into the operating system, creating a specialized kernel to manage AI agent resources like memory, storage, and scheduling. It treats AI agents as first-class operating system processes for improved execution speed and efficiency.

    How is AIOS different from regular AI agent frameworks?

    Traditional AI agent frameworks like LangChain or AutoGPT run agents as standalone applications. AIOS integrates agent management at the operating system level, providing kernel-level resource allocation, intelligent scheduling across agents, and optimized memory management—similar to how a computer OS manages running programs.

    Why does AIOS matter for businesses?

    AIOS matters because businesses increasingly run multiple AI agents simultaneously. Without proper resource management, agents compete for memory, storage, and compute—leading to slow performance, crashes, and wasted resources. AIOS solves this by providing dedicated OS-level management for agent workloads.

    What are the key components of AIOS?

    AIOS includes an LLM kernel for embedding language models into the OS, an agent scheduler for managing execution priority, a memory manager for optimizing agent context and storage, a storage manager for persistent data, and an access control system for security and permissions.
